What do you click to access plugin settings in Logic Pro?

Accessing plugin settings in Logic Pro is accomplished by clicking the blue triangle next to the plugin in the mixer. This triangular icon serves as an indicator or button to expand or open the settings for that specific plugin, allowing users to customize its parameters. By clicking on this blue triangle, you can view the plugin interface, where you can make adjustments to settings such as effects, EQ, or dynamics processing. This method provides a direct and intuitive way to interact with plugins without having to navigate through other menus or settings. Understanding this functionality enables users to efficiently utilize the tools available within Logic Pro for mixing and editing their audio projects.
